UNC
Universal Naming Convention or Uniform Naming Convention, a PC format for specifying
the location of resources on a local-area network (LAN). UNC uses the following format:
\\server-name\shared-resource-pathname
So, for example, to access the file test.txt in the directory examples on the shared server silo,
you would write:
\\silo\examples\test.txt
You can also use UNC to identify shared peripheral devices, such as printers. The idea behind
UNC is to provide a format so that each shared resource can be identified with a unique
address.
UNC is supported by Windows and many network operating systems.
XML
Extensible Markup Language. XML enables the definition, transmission, validation, and
interpretation of data between applications and between organizations.
